Doja Cat Tells Fans Not to Bring Their Kids to Her Shows: ‘I Don’t Make Music for Children’

Doja Cat isn’t right here to run a day-care middle or host your loved ones outings. The Scarlet rapper mentioned the express nature of her music on X Friday (April 26), and identified that the lyrics she writes aren’t essentially for kids’s ears.

“idk what the f–ok you suppose that is however i don’t make music for kids so depart your youngsters at residence motherf–ker,” she wrote with out indicating what led her to share her ideas on the matter.

The 28-year-old, who’s gearing up for the abroad leg of her Scarlet Tour, then addressed among the raunchy lyrics in her songs that don’t make sense to have youngsters singing alongside to. “Im rapping about c– why are you bringing your offspring to my present,” Doja Cat continued. “Rappin about eatin d–ok and pissin on his v-cut, depart your mistake at residence*”

Doja Cat was one of many standout acts at Coachella 2024, rocking scanty apparel and lingerie all through her set whereas performing her hedonistic anthems. (She additionally just lately launched a limited-edition Funko Pop! figurine modeled after her Coachella look.)

The “Say So” artist will headline a few radio live shows, together with Sizzling 97’s Summer season Jam occasion, earlier than heading to Europe for a handful of reveals and competition units in England, Amsterdam, Italy and extra.

On Scarlet‘s “F–ok the Women (FTG),” Doja Cat addressed how she shouldn’t be checked out as a job mannequin for youths. “Since when was y’all my bastard youngsters/ Go forward and lift y’all self/ Come get ya bada–youngsters, no want to say,” she raps.

Scarlet debuted at No. 4 on the Billboard 200 in October with 72,000 album models bought within the first week.
